Overview
ISO 8871-3:2003 specifies laboratory methods to determine the number of visible and subvisible particles released from elastomeric parts used with parenterals and pharmaceutical devices. The standard addresses particle contamination that can occur from superficial contamination or from fragments produced when closures are pierced. ISO 8871-3:2003 defines sampling, rinse and measurement techniques but does not set acceptance limits - those are to be agreed between manufacturer and user.
Key topics and technical requirements
- Scope: Tests quantify particles detached from elastomeric closures by rinsing; applicable to primary packaging and device elastomeric parts.
- Visible-particle method (Clauses 3.x):
- Particle size classes by longest dimension: Class I >25–≤50 µm, Class II >50–≤100 µm, Class III >100 µm.
- Use membrane filters (max pore 0.8 µm) with 3 mm × 3 mm grid; filter color recommendations provided (medium grey, CIE coordinates).
- Rinse fluid: 3 g polysorbate 80 (Tween 80) per 10 L purified water (ISO 3696 grade).
- Shaking: horizontal circle 12 mm ±1 mm at 300–350 min⁻¹; two 50 ml rinse steps per test.
- Microscope: ~×50 magnification for counting.
- Blank-test acceptance: ≤5 particles Class I, ≤1 particle Class II, none Class III.
- Subvisible-particle method (Clauses 4.x):
- Particle classes (equivalent-sphere diameter): ≥2–<5 µm, ≥5–<10 µm, ≥10–<25 µm, ≥25 µm.
- Use particle-free water (≤100 particles >2 µm per 5 ml) and a light-extinction particle counter (light obscuration).
- Test uses 100 ml water with same shaking profile; counts measured 15–30 minutes after shaking.
- Blank-test acceptance: not more than 100 particles >2 µm per 5 ml.
- Reporting: surface area tested, number of parts, individual and average counts per 10 cm², blank results and total counts.
Applications and users
- Quality control and incoming inspection of elastomeric stoppers, seals and closures for injectable products.
- Used by pharmaceutical manufacturers, rubber/elastomer suppliers, contract testing labs, and regulatory QA teams to characterize particulate-release potential.
- Supports risk assessments for sterile parenteral packaging, contamination control, and supplier qualification.
Related standards
- ISO 8871 (other parts): Part 1 (extractables), Part 2 (identification), Part 4 (biological), Part 5 (functional tests).
- ISO 3696:1997 - Water for analytical laboratory use (used for rinse water quality).
- ISO 14644-1 - Cleanroom classification (environmental control recommendations).
